Output 43a2860bcb5963bda74f8f4e13068fbf80b30ec0ac54b0e4c9d8f7d752def372:0

value
142901
script pubkey
OP_0 OP_PUSHBYTES_20 cd878722c8d5fb654d0ee70b642ca19d9042ed89
address
bc1qekrcwgkg6hak2ngwuu9kgt9pnkgy9mvfh5ch99
transaction
43a2860bcb5963bda74f8f4e13068fbf80b30ec0ac54b0e4c9d8f7d752def372
spent
true